jQuery $.ajax 使用字符串数组调用 Web Api

作者:编程家 分类: ajax 时间:2025-07-30

# 使用 jQuery 的 $.ajax 方法调用 Web Api 的字符串数组

在Web开发中,经常需要使用JavaScript与后端进行数据交互。jQuery提供了强大的`$.ajax`方法,使得与Web Api进行通信变得更加简便。本文将介绍如何使用`$.ajax`方法传递字符串数组到Web Api,并提供一个简单的案例代码。

## 发送字符串数组到 Web Api

首先,我们需要确保Web Api端能够正确地接收并处理字符串数组。为此,我们可以创建一个接受字符串数组的Web Api方法,通过HTTP POST请求发送数据。下面是一个简单的C# Web Api方法示例:

csharp

[HttpPost]

public IHttpActionResult ProcessStringArray([FromBody] string[] stringArray)

{

// 处理接收到的字符串数组

// 在这里可以进行任何必要的逻辑操作

return Ok("String array processed successfully");

}

## 使用 $.ajax 方法发送字符串数组

现在,让我们使用jQuery的`$.ajax`方法来发送字符串数组到上述的Web Api方法。以下是一个简单的HTML页面,其中包含了一个按钮,点击该按钮将触发`$.ajax`请求:

html

使用 $.ajax 发送字符串数组

##

在本文中,我们学习了如何使用jQuery的`$.ajax`方法发送字符串数组到Web Api。首先,我们确保Web Api端有一个相应的方法来接收和处理字符串数组。然后,通过简单的HTML页面和JavaScript代码,我们演示了如何使用`$.ajax`方法构建并发送请求。这种方法可以应用于许多Web开发场景,为前端与后端之间的数据交互提供了一种便捷的方式。希望这个简单的例子能够帮助你更好地理解如何使用jQuery进行Web开发中的异步请求。